Porte d'entrée du centre historique entièrement accessible.
Construite en pierre grise ciselée, elle représente la première arche d'accès construite lors de la construction de la troisième enceinte de la ville au XVIe siècle. Sur la façade extérieure, on distingue clairement un petit balcon datant du XVIe siècle, sur lequel sont sculptés les armoiries de la République.

Piazzetta del Titano
Piazza del Titano is a lively corner of the historic center of San Marino, which has been included among the UNESCO heritage sites. There is no better place to appreciate the architectural beauty of San Marino and to people-watch than sitting at the tables of a bar. The square also houses a splendid museum, which illustrates the archaeological and artistic history of the nation and the evolution of its currency.
From the center of Piazza del Titano, observe the austere architecture of its buildings, which feature recurring features such as pillars and simple balconies. On one side of the square an imposing arched door is visible. Under one of the arches there is a bas-relief representing San Marino as a bricklayer.
The main attraction of the square is the State Museum, which occupies the rooms of the Pergami Belluzzi palace. It contains around 5000 artefacts that illustrate the history of San Marino and that of ancient civilizations from around the world. The duration can be variable.

Cava dei Balestrieri
The Cava dei Balestrieri is a historical landmark of the city and can be easily visited as soon as you arrive in the historic center because it is located a stone's throw from the cable car stop.
Its initial use was as a quarry for the recovery of materials and for the extraction of the stone necessary for the restoration of the nearby Palazzo Pubblico.
From the 1960s onwards this area was equipped for shooting with the large Italian crossbow, an ancient game of arms which is today part of the historical recovery and folklore of the Republic of San Marino. The inauguration of the Cava dei Balestrieri officially took place on 3 September 1971.
The duration can be variable.

Place de la Liberté
It is the heart of San Marino political life and its history and it is here that the installation ceremony of the Captains Regent takes place every 6 months: on 1 April and 1 October every year.
The Palazzo Pubblico stands on the so-called "Pianello", or Piazza della Libertà and stands on the site of the Domus Comunis Magna, built between 1380 and 1392 and repaired several times.
In the second half of the 19th century the Palazzo Vecchio had the appearance of a seventeenth-century building: on 17 May 1884 the foundation stone of the current Palace was laid, based on a design by the Roman architect Francesco Azzurri, president of the Accademia di San Luca in Rome , by local stonecutters directed by the San Marino master builder Giuseppe Reffi, using stones extracted from the Titano quarries.
The inauguration took place on 30 September 1894, the speaker of the ceremony was Giosuè Carducci who on the occasion gave the famous speech on "perpetual freedom". The duration can be variable.

Basilica del Santo Marino
The Basilica of San Marino is the main Catholic place of worship in the City of San Marino, belonging to the diocese of San Marino-Montefeltro; it is dedicated to the patron saint of the city and the state. It is located in Piazzale Domus Plebis. The duration can be variable.

Torri di San Marino
La Guaita, also known as the Fortress or simply the First Tower, is the largest and oldest of the three fortresses that dominate the city of San Marino. The duration can be variable.
